恪理画廊 (Caelis Galería) 欣然宣布,将于2023年8月15日至9月28日呈现⻄班牙艺术家杰米·桑格罗个展《伸出援手》,迈入以油画形式描绘的成人世界讽刺游乐场。杰米·桑格罗生于1980年,主要聚焦于探索肌理的塑造与色彩的表达。来自艰难时期的黑白历史照片构成其灵感的出发点,俏皮、诙谐的卡通人物则注入一抹亮色,对照与张力之间,一场关于超现实、波普和讽刺元素之间的意义实验得以展开。

失孤的火鸡在窸窣的干草垛上等待救援,火焰翻滚包裹⻝物与短暂的平和,⻢克沁机枪被似乎无济于事胡萝卜填堵住枪口......十三幅作品所展现的似是一片不⻅硝烟的静谧荒原,由休憩、演练、救 助、勘探、反战等组成的分主题,显然为照片背后的艰苦岁月增添了几分柔化的生活色彩。艺术家自述道,在选定作品主题之前,曾在一片数量惊人的图片前展开广泛的筛选,在⻅证一系列的悲伤瞬间后,最终选定能与自己引发共鸣的自然主题,以抒发对战争残酷性、荒谬性的反思。

通过将摄影语言转化为极为仿真的绘画语言,对媒介转译功能的探讨随即被抛出。援引李普曼的“拟态环境”概念,在与充斥流行符号的现实环境并行延展的集体记忆,何种描绘更接近事件本身的真相?它们在何种程度上参与全景认知的塑造?另一层面上,一种微妙的⻆力寓于其中,它由被替换的⻆色、新诞生的场景小品所暗示,并无一不与原始镜头发生着崭新的互动。这种类似于蒙太奇的手法,引导观众情不自禁地补足叙事片段,急切地解开绘画镜头所定格的故事。

层层历史碎片背后,杰米·桑格罗致敬了超写实主义对细节的至臻刻画。初观杰米的作品,映入眼帘的通常是古旧却丰富的黑白色调。然而在表面之下,油画材质⻛干后形成的粗糙的纹理和锋利的边缘揭示了选择性处理的变革过程,超越了单纯的复制,成为精心挑选的真实性再现。格式塔美学成 为对这虚实莫辨现象的解读入口,此种“不同于经验中的”但同时“与之有所联系”的刺激性图式,能在最大限度上触发知觉的探索机制,构成贡布里希所言的互文性。写实带来的“过近”体验反而滋生出生理上的陌生感,拼凑起多感官的复合式碎片,心中的惯常形象也由此被物象所涵盖的意义替代。

回到展览主题提供的另一条线索,我们离艺术家希望描述的现实真相究竟相距多远?场景中出现于 困难时期的人物具有军事领域的定位符,反映步入成人世界后所面临的暗沉脆弱一面。裹挟酸性色彩的卡通元素引用自电子游戏与美国电影,它们指向被遗忘的童年,流露着对纯真的丧失及原因的 反思,并试图在严肃的军事环境中找寻一丝微笑。克制忠实的摹写与跳脱幽默的拼接中,杰米试图向无解的种种严酷境遇“伸出援手”,在内省和距离之间取得和谐的平衡,溯古观今,以建立更具深度的共识。

 

Caelis Galería is delighted to announce the solo exhibition "Reach Out" by Spanish artist Jaime Sancorlo, which will be held from August 15th to September 28th, 2023. The exhibition showcases a series of oil paintings depicting the adult world as a playground of irony. Born in 1980, Jaime Sancorlo primarily focuses on exploring texture and expressing color. Drawing inspiration from historical black-and-white photographs from difficult periods, he injects a playful and witty touch of cartoon characters to create a juxtaposition of surreal, pop, and ironic elements, leading to a meaningful artistic experiment.

The thirteen artworks presented in the exhibition evoke a serene and quiet wilderness, seemingly untouched by the smoke of war. Each canvas presents a unique theme - from leisure and practice to rescue and armistice - infusing the difficult times captured in the photographs with a soft touch of life and vibrancy. Before settling on these themes, Jaime meticulously selected from an impressive array of images, choosing those that deeply resonated with his soul, expressing his contemplation of the cruelty and absurdity of war.

Through his astute artistic prowess, Jaime skillfully transforms the language of photography into a hyperrealistic painting language, prompting profound questions about the interplay between reality and the influx of popular symbols in our collective memory. Engaging in this thought-provoking exploration, visitors are encouraged to ponder which portrayal comes closest to the truth of the depicted events and to what extent their participation shapes their panoramic perception. At the heart of this artistic dialogue lies a subtle dance of replaced characters and newly birthed scene vignettes, sparking a fresh interplay with the original lens. This artistic montage empowers viewers to naturally fill in the missing narrative pieces, eagerly unraveling the tales suspended within each frame.

Behind the layers of historical fragments, Jaime Sancorlo pays tribute to the meticulous detailing of hyperrealism. At first glance, his artworks usually present an aged and somber black-and-white color palette. Yet, beneath the surface, the coarse texture and sharp edges reveal a transformative process of selective treatment, transcending mere reproduction to become an embodiment of carefully chosen authenticity. The Gestalt aesthetics offer an interpretative entry point to this phenomenon of ambiguity, where the stimulating patterns are "different from one's experience" yet "connected to it." This maximizes the triggering of perceptual exploration, as described by Gombrich as intertextuality. The "too close" experience brought by realism, in turn, fosters a physiological sense of unfamiliarity, piecing together composite fragments of multi-sensory input, replacing the conventional mental images with the meanings conveyed by the objects.

Delving deeper into the exhibition's themes, the personas encountered amidst these trying times are adorned with military signifiers, mirroring the somber aspects of adulthood. The acid-colored cartoon elements reference electronic games and American movies, pointing to a forgotten childhood, expressing the loss of innocence and contemplation of its reasons, and attempting to find a trace of a smile amidst the serious military environment. Jaime's artistic craftsmanship, blending restrained and faithful depictions with humorous assemblages, extends an empathetic hand to the numerous harsh realities, encouraging viewers to strike a harmonious balance between introspection and distance. By embracing the past and present, we can build profound consensus, awakening a newfound depth within ourselves.
